A registered agent plays a vital role in ensuring adherence with state regulations for businesses, including limited liability companies and corporations. Every state mandates that businesses appoint a registered agent to accept service of process, legal notices, and government correspondence. This obligation ensures that a reliable point of contact is available for judicial matters, enabling timely communication and necessary actions to be taken by the business.

The responsibilities of a registered agent go beyond just accepting documents. They must be present during regular working hours to receive critical notices, keep accurate records, and send information to the company owner without delay. Neglect to meet these legal obligations can result in penalties, loss of good standing, or even default judgments against the company. Therefore, choosing a qualified registered agent is crucial to ensure adherence with all statutory requirements.

Companies should also be aware that each jurisdiction has particular legal requirements regarding the qualifications of registered agents. Generally, the registered agent must be a resident of the state or a corporation licensed to conduct business within that region. Understanding these legal criteria is crucial when choosing a designated agent service, as it impacts the overall compliance posture of the business and mitigates potential legal risks.
